Mitchell Markowitz is a clinical social worker, MC9640, based in Saco, ME. He offers services to individuals across various age groups, including teenagers (13 to 18), adults (18 to 65), and elders (65+). Mitchell provides support for a range of concerns, such as addiction, att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D), alcohol/drug use, anxiety, depression, family stress, general well-being and mental health concerns, men's and women's issues, obsessive compulsive disorder (OCD), parenting, trauma and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), relationship stress, sleeping well, spirituality, and student life. He offers services to individuals, families, and couples. Mitchell Markowitz utilizes a diverse set of therapeutic approaches, including c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), strength-based therapy, mindfulness-based cognitive therapy (MBCT), family/marital therapy, solution focused brief therapy (SFBT), family systems therapy, interpersonal therapy, psychodynamic therapy, relational therapy, eclectic therapy, coaching, compassion-focused therapy, positive psychology, existential therapy, and multicultural therapy. He offers services in English (US).
